Job Description

Maintain excellent quality and productivity standards for all client projects; adhere to project scripts and guidelines.

Manage day to day activities of patient and health care provider support requests and deliverables across multiple communication channels in a Contact Center i.e. Phone, Fax, Chat, email, etc. approximately 50 percent of time.

Ensure all support requested is captured within the Case Management system.

Serve as subject matter expert for program team responding to questions in a timely manner.

Conduct quality call monitoring for program team as directed by program leadership.

Escalate issues identified by self or project team to appropriate program leadership.

Ensure timely processing and resolution of cases meeting productivity and quality requirements.

Escalate complex cases, when appropriate.

Qualifications

  • High School Diploma required
  • Associates or Bachelor's Degree preferred, or 1-2 years of healthcare/healthcare reimbursement experience.
  • Working knowledge and experience with health insurance and Rx reimbursement
  • Understands HIPAA and privacy laws and requirements and maintains patient confidentiality
  • Experience with Adverse Event and Product Quality Complaint reporting preferred.
  • Maintains compliance with program business rules, standard operating procedures, and guidelines.
